In Avondale heat, the salon floor is dealing with outdoor load, roof heat, glass exposure, occupied rooms, blow dryers, lighting, product use, closed treatment doors, and long appointments. A system that is only slightly weak can become a daily client-experience problem.

What we see for salons & spas in Avondale.
Salon HVAC complaints in Avondale usually start with uneven comfort. Styling stations near glass get hot, shampoo areas feel damp, nail tables hold odor, and small treatment rooms do not recover after doors open and close all day. In older retail centers, the original HVAC layout may have been built for generic retail, not dryers, steam, wax, chemicals, and long client dwell time. The result is a space where the thermostat says one thing, the stylist feels another, and the client notices the difference during a long service.
Chemical fumes and product odors are not solved by turning the thermostat down. Nail products, color services, sprays, disinfectants, and cleaning products need the right ventilation approach, and exhaust can change how the comfort unit behaves. If exhaust pulls too hard without a reasonable makeup path, the salon may feel drafty, dusty, or impossible to cool in the afternoon. If exhaust is weak or poorly located, odor may linger near clients even while the air conditioner runs.
Spa rooms add another layer. Facial rooms, massage rooms, waxing rooms, and lash rooms often need quiet airflow, steady temperature, and better humidity control than the main salon floor. Small split systems, poor thermostat locations, clogged drains, dirty coils, and weak fan motors can make those rooms swing between stuffy and cold. Clients read that as poor service, even when the technician is doing good work. Closed doors, low airflow, warm equipment, and moisture from treatments can make a small room behave very differently from the open retail floor.
Avondale's established building stock matters. Many rooftop units serving retail bays are old enough to be unreliable but still repairable in some cases. Others have repeated compressor, blower, drain, or control failures that point toward replacement. In APS and SRP mixed territory, energy costs and utility details vary by site, but long run times and weak recovery are common symptoms. We also see systems that were never adjusted after a salon added chairs, nail stations, treatment rooms, or laundry and staff areas, so the load changed but the airflow path did not.

Why does my salon smell like product even when the AC runs?
Cooling and ventilation are related, but they are not the same. Product odor may come from weak exhaust, poor makeup air, clogged filters, dirty coils, low outdoor air, bad room layout, or exhaust that pulls air the wrong way through the space. Turning the thermostat lower can make clients colder without fixing odor. We inspect the HVAC equipment and the airflow symptoms, then document what can be corrected through HVAC service. We also look at whether closed rooms, blocked returns, nail tables, color areas, or cleaning routines are concentrating odor in one part of the salon.

What causes spa rooms to feel humid or stuffy?
Common causes include low airflow, dirty coils, clogged condensate drains, oversized equipment that does not run long enough, poor thermostat placement, closed doors, weak returns, and moisture from treatments or cleaning. Some rooms were added inside retail bays without enough HVAC planning. We inspect the equipment and room behavior before recommending repair, controls changes, ventilation coordination, or replacement. A small room can also feel stuffy because the door stays closed for privacy, the supply air is weak, or the return path is limited, even when the main salon floor feels acceptable.
Should I repair or replace the rooftop unit over my salon?
That depends on the unit's age, condition, repair history, refrigerant status, compressor health, blower condition, coil condition, controls, roof access, and how badly downtime affects your bookings. Avondale has many retail spaces with equipment reaching the mid-life or end-of-life decision point. We inspect in person and provide a flat-rate written quote with the scope documented in writing. If the unit has repeated failures, poor recovery, chronic drain problems, or weak airflow across several rooms, we explain that context so the decision is not based only on the latest repair.
